Jenkins Law Library
Jenkins Law Library Company of the City of Philadelphia was founded in 1802 in a small room in Independence Hall in Philadelphia, Pennsylvania. It was formed by a group of lawyers who set out to provide legal information for the growing law community in the City. Philadelphia’s law library holds the prestigious position as America’s first and oldest law library.
About Dave Koller
Koller practices exclusively in employment law representing individual clients who have been wronged on the workplace. He fights for the rights of his clients in a wide range of employment claims. As such, he handles sexual harassment, discrimination, wrongful termination, wage and compensation, Title VII, retaliation and whistleblower, Family and Medical Leave Act, OSHA and unsafe working conditions, non-competition agreements, and COVID-19 related litigation. He appears before the state and federal courts in the Eastern, Middle and Western Districts of Pennsylvania. He also appears in the District of New Jersey and has argued before the 3rd U.S. Circuit Court of Appeals. He graduated from the University of Pennsylvania and Villanova Law School where he served as president of the student body.
